The General Officer Commanding the Northern Command of the Ghana Armed Forces, Brigadier General Matthew Essien on behalf of The Chief of Army Staff, Major General Thomas Oppong-Pepprah, has commissioned a Counselling and Family Life Centre for the Command at the 6 Infantry Battalion Headquarters, Kamina Barracks at Tamale in the Northern Region.
Among other things, the facility is expected to enhance soldier-civilian relations.
The center will ensure periodic counseling to help equip soldiers to behave more professionally and improve their performance.

When highlighting the importance of the center for officers, civilian staff, and families under the command, the Director of Army Religious Affairs, Colonel Peter Duodoo, said periodically, "Counselling will no doubt, help equip Soldiers with professional behavior and exceptional performance. I'm assuring troops who would consult the facility of full confidentiality", he indicated.
The Guest of Honour, GOC Northern Command, on behalf of the Chief of Army Staff, Major General Thomas Oppong-Pepprah, commended the Commanding Officer of the 6 Infantry Battalion, Lieutenant Colonel Jerry Ankuyi for initiating and completing the Counselling and Family Life Centre with the support of his officers and men.

"This center, I know very well, will also address the well-being of our troops under Command", Brigadier General Matthew Essien said.
The Commanding Officer 6 Infantry Battalion, Lieutenant Colonel Jerry Ankuyi, on his part, expressed his profound gratitude to the Chief of Army Staff for the establishment of a Counselling and Family Life Centre in Kamina and his continuous support.
He assured the High Command that the facility would be fully utilized to realize its intended objectives.
Present at the event were the Air Force Base Commander, Air Commodore Joshua Mensah-Larkai, the Command Logistics Officer Colonel Francis Bannerman, and other key staff appointments at the Command.
